A matrix is just numbers arranged neatly in rows and columns — and it turns out to be one of the tidiest tools in mathematics. In this lesson we learn to read a matrix and state its order, then add and subtract matrices, multiply by a scalar, and tackle the big skill: multiplying two matrices row by column. We meet the identity and zero matrices, work out the determinant and inverse of a 2×2, and finish by using that inverse to solve two simultaneous equations at once.

What you'll learn in this lesson

By the end you should be able to (NSSCO Mathematics 10.1):

  • Represent information as a matrix of any order and state the order (rows × columns) of a matrix
  • Add and subtract matrices of the same order, entry by entry
  • Multiply a matrix by a scalar
  • Multiply two matrices row-by-column, and decide when a matrix product is possible
  • Use the zero matrix and the identity matrix
  • Calculate the determinant of a 2×2 matrix
  • Find the inverse of a non-singular 2×2 matrix
  • Solve simultaneous linear equations by the matrix (inverse) method
